Output 7bc73094efd6ea2bf423f201194b184702b599f3fdbfd11846313c92df09689b:9

value
1132313
script pubkey
OP_0 OP_PUSHBYTES_20 54512b8cc77b44f2a670348ab78829e28ab7a2f2
address
bc1q23gjhrx80dz09fnsxj9t0zpfu29t0ghjk7839r
transaction
7bc73094efd6ea2bf423f201194b184702b599f3fdbfd11846313c92df09689b
confirmations
254192
spent
true